编程的奥秘解析_下面我们将分别进行探讨_编程的奥秘是否每个人都能够掌握
编程的奥秘解析
编程的奥秘主要涉及两大方面:逻辑思维能力的培养和对问题细致的分析。下面我们将分别进行探讨。
逻辑思维能力的培养
逻辑思维是编程的核心,它对提升编码效率和质量起着决定性的作用。一个优秀的程序员不仅能够写出符合需求的代码,还能以最优的方式解决问题。
以下是一些关于逻辑思维能力培养的关键点:
- 将复杂问题分解为小部分,逐一解决。
- 通过练习选择最合适的数据结构和高效的算法。
- 例如,在大量数据排序时,选择快速排序而非冒泡排序。
对问题细致的分析
在编程过程中,对问题进行细致分析至关重要。这包括对需求的理解和拆解,以及考虑程序可能遇到的边界情况和异常处理。
以下是一些关于细致分析的关键点:
- 考虑各种可能的用户输入,包括异常值和空值。
- 确保程序能够妥善处理这些情况,提升用户体验。
学习理解能力
学习和理解新知识是编程过程中不可或缺的一环。技术的快速发展要求程序员不断地学习新的编程语言、框架和工具。
以下是一些关于学习理解能力的关键点:
- 掌握新知识,并将已有知识与新学到的知识结合,解决实际问题。
- 理解不同编程范式的优势和缺点,选择最适合当前项目的技术栈。
编程是一门既严谨又充满创造性的技术。深入了解其奥秘,不仅需要掌握一系列的技术和工具,更重要的是要培养逻辑思维、问题分析和持续学习的能力。
通过不断的实践、学习和反思,程序员能够有效地解决问题,开发出高质量的软件产品。
相关问答FAQs
问题 | 答案 |
---|---|
什么是编程的奥秘? | 编程的奥秘是关于多方面的因素和技巧,它们共同构成了编程的核心和基础。 |
如何理解编程的奥秘? | 理解编程的奥秘是一个渐进的过程,可以通过学习基础知识、解读源代码、参与开源项目和深入研究特定领域的编程知识来拓展理解。 |
编程的奥秘是否每个人都能够掌握? | 编程的奥秘可以说是每个人都可以掌握的,但取决于个人的学习能力、兴趣和动力。 |